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.06.29;
Скачать: CL | DM;

Вниз

Блок-схема программы.   Найти похожие ветки 

 
Санёк   (2005-05-26 00:36) [0]

Доброй ночи!
Делаю свой курсовой на дельфи.
естественно для его оформления нужны блок-схемы алгоритмов моей программы.
В институте ООП мы еще не затрагивали, пока что сидим на Си 3.1
для него блок-схемы я уже умею составлять.
также я умею могу составлять блок-схемы отдельных алгоритмов. Но вот как составить блок-схему всей программы в целом?
ведь программа выполняется не последовательно.
Подскажите пожалуйста, что можно почитать по данному вопросу или посоветуйте, как это правильнее сделать.
Большое спасибо.


 
Просто Джо ©   (2005-05-26 00:46) [1]

Ну, сейчас начнется :))

По сабжу. Я так понимаю, что нужна просто схема логики взаимодействия отдельных подсистем программы. Например, связь между алгоритмами (в каком случае какой выполняется), подсистемой визуализации и расчетов и т.д.


 
lifo ©   (2005-05-26 00:57) [2]

>>ведь программа выполняется не последовательно.
А как она выполняеться ???
Тебе надо всего лишь написать блок схему алгоритма реализованого а твоей программе ...


 
Defunct ©   (2005-05-26 04:24) [3]

> так понимаю, что нужна просто схема логики взаимодействия отдельных подсистем программы.

Скорее даже проще. Блок схема программы это просто множество модулей обозначенных в виде прямоугольников и связи между ними.

Но тут надо не на форуме спрашивать, а к преподавателю подойти и у него узнать, что он хочет видеть на блок-схеме программы.


 
Viktop   (2005-05-26 06:32) [4]

Скачай Ch 01
http://podgoretsky.com/ftp/Docs/Delphi/Fleonov/Bibble/


 
Kerk ©   (2005-05-26 08:43) [5]

Программа AvtoShema V 2.2. Эта программа предназначена для построения Блок-схемы алгоритма по готовому коду синтаксиса "Паскаль". Загрузка кода как через модуль PAS так и через буфер обмена. Возможна загрузка из сохраненных файлов *.txt; Пригодится для лучшего понимания чужого кода. А также забытого своего для тех кто ленится комментировать. Также благодаря возможности строить схемы через буфер обмена можно строить Блок-схемы кусков кода прямо во время их написания скопировав код и выбрать контекстное меню иконки данной программы в трее. Можно строить цветные блок-схемы. Настраивать размеры блоков, строить очень длинные блок-схемы.
http://kladovka.net.ru/index.php?action=downloadfile&filename=Shemaisx.zip&directory=Programs
:)


 
vl_chel ©   (2005-05-26 09:28) [6]

Defunct ©   (26.05.05 04:24) [3] -> абсолютно правильное мнение

Блоксхемы всей программы (приложения) не существует, есть блоксхемы предопределенных процессов, диаграммы потоков данных, структурная схема программы.

скорее всего в курсовике преподавателя интересуют блоксхемы предопределенных процессов


 
Mx ©   (2005-05-26 09:42) [7]

Тут можно и на UML глянуть, а составлять блок-схему ВСЕЙ проги на Delphi и в самом деле изврат, надо конкретнее. Однако, по своему опыту общения с некоторыми преподавателями могу сказать, что не все понимают это и считают, что для Delphi"йсого проекта вполне можно сбацать удобочитаемое с "Начало"-"Конец".


 
vl_chel ©   (2005-05-26 09:45) [8]

;))
 начало
    |
иницмализация
    |
создание окна
    |
 запуск
    |
  конец


 
Санёк   (2005-05-26 21:24) [9]


> Defunct ©   (26.05.05 04:24) [3]

наверное это прозвучит странно, но это было первое, что я сделал, когда увидел требования по оформлению.

> Mx ©   (26.05.05 09:42) [7]

вы абсолютно верно отразили дальнейшее развитие моего диалога с преподом.


> Kerk ©   (26.05.05 08:43) [5]

Это которую Дмитрий написал?
НЭТ, СПАСЫБА.


> Viktop   (26.05.05 06:32) [4]

руководство по обозначениям на блок-схемах у меня имеется, спасибо.


 
Kerk ©   (2005-05-26 21:25) [10]

Санёк   (26.05.05 21:24) [9]
> Kerk ©   (26.05.05 08:43) [5]

Это которую Дмитрий написал?
НЭТ, СПАСЫБА.


Дык шутю я, шутю :)


 
Defunct ©   (2005-05-28 19:06) [11]

Санёк   (26.05.05 21:24) [9]
> но это было первое, что я сделал, когда увидел требования по оформлению.
>вы абсолютно верно отразили дальнейшее развитие моего диалога с преподом.

Ну, и что же он Вам сказал?


 
Санёк   (2005-05-29 03:18) [12]


> Defunct ©   (28.05.05 19:06) [11]

хех...
как что?
Дословно: "От вас требуется изобразить блок-схему вашей программы и алгоритмов, входящих в нее".
препод застрял где-то в конце восьмидесятых.
он часто путает Си с Паскалем...
вобщем клиника.

буду ему в этот вторник показывать алгоритм Button1.Visible:=False....


 
Petr V. Abramov ©   (2005-05-29 12:18) [13]

ИМХО, блок-схемы бывают только у алгоритмов.



Страницы: 1 вся ветка

Текущий архив: 2005.06.29;
Скачать: CL | DM;

Наверх




Память: 0.5 MB
Время: 0.086 c
3-1116718926
grol
2005-05-22 03:42
2005.06.29
Как из ADOQuery ков перенести информацию в Excel?


1-1117982090
Cijgan
2005-06-05 18:34
2005.06.29
предусмотреть ввод данных в Edit


4-1115309163
Гость_01
2005-05-05 20:06
2005.06.29
Как запустить программу и получить handle ее окна ?


14-1117477233
Alexander Panov
2005-05-30 22:20
2005.06.29
Подключение 2-х провайдеров.


1-1117889389
Петр
2005-06-04 16:49
2005.06.29
Утечка памяти